Connection and function of the switching outputs
Switching Outputs
The S80 door control unit has two potential free relay switching outputs (changeover contacts, see wiring diagram) each with
a switching capacity of 250 V AC / 5 A.
MLS Basic Card
The relays are actuated by the operating cams S7 and S8 of the drive:
• The orange cam S7 de-energizes relay 2
• The green cam S8 de-energizes relay 1
As a result it is possible to implement, for example, a door status indicator.
MLS Professional Card
With the MLS Professional Card the two relays have different switching functions, depending on the settings of the DIP switch-
es 1.5,1.6 and 1.7 in accordance with the following table.
Switching functions of the indicator outputs DIP 1.5 DIP 1.6 DIP 1.7
Door status
Relay 1 switches on at the top door end limit.
Relay 2 switches on at the bottom door end limit.
In the event of door movement, both relays are off.
OFF OFF OFF
Trafc lights + yard light with time delay
Relay 1 switches on at the top door end limit
(trafc light red/green via changeover contacts).
At the beginning of each door movement relay 2 switches on and remains on - at
the end of each door movement it switches off after a delay of 120s (time Z6).
ON OFF OFF
Trafc lights + yard light control pulse
Relay 1 switches on at the top door end limit (trafc light red/green via change over
contacts). At the beginning of each door movement relay 2 switches on for 1s
(passing contact, pulse to actuate a time-delay relay).
ON OFF ON
Warning light + yard light with time delay
Relay 1 switches on when the door leaves either of the end limits and remains on.
At the beginning of each door movement relay 2 switches on and remains on -
120s (time Z6) after the end of each door movement it switches off after a delay.
If automatic closing has been set, the two relays switch on as soon as the early
warning time (3 s, time Z3) begins.
ON ON OFF
Warning light ashing + yard light pulse
Relay 1 switches on when the door leaves either of the end limits and ashes at a
rate of 1 Hz.
At the beginning of each door movement relay 2 switches on for 1s
(passing contact, pulse to actuate a time-delay relay).
If automatic closing has been set, the two relays switch on as soon as the early
warning time (3 s, time Z3) begins.
ON ON ON
Warning light ashing + yard light with time delay and early warning
Relay 1 switches on 3 s (early warning time Z3) before the door leaves either of
the end limits and remains on.
Relay 2 switches on 3 s (early warning time Z3) before beginning each door mo-
vement and remains on - at the end of each door movement it switches off with a
delay of 120s (time Z6).
OFF ON OFF
Warning light ashing + yard light control pulse, with early warning
Relay 1 switches on for 3 s (early warning time Z3) before the door leaves either of
the end limits and ashes at a rate of 1 Hz.
Relay 2 switches on 3 s (early warning time Z3) before the beginning of each door
movement for 1 s (passing contact, pulse to actuate a time-delay relay).
OFF ON ON
